早前阅读高性能JavaScript一书所做笔记。 一、Loading and Execution 加载和运行 从加载和运行角度优化,源于JavaScript运行会阻塞UI更新,JavaScript脚本的下载、解析、运行过程中,页面的下载和解析过程都会停下来等待,因为脚本可...
早前阅读高性能JavaScript一书所做笔记。 一、Loading and Execution 加载和运行 从加载和运行角度优化,源于JavaScript运行会阻塞UI更新,JavaScript脚本的下载、解析、运行过程中,页面的下载和解析过程都会停下来等待,因为脚本可...
第一部分:关于script 当把js脚本通过script标签放在head中的时候,早期浏览器在遇到script的时候会阻止浏览器加载和渲染html。直到javascript脚本被下载并执行完,且这些javascript是依次下载和执行,不能并行。如下面这个图所示: ...
1. 前言 最近在看司徒正美的《JavaScript框架设计》,看到异步编程的那一章介绍了jsdeferred这个库,觉得很有意思,花了几天的时间研究了一下代码,在此做一下分享。 异步编程是编写js的一个很重要的理念,特别是在处理复...
...导致内存泄漏(主要好像是ie下,没有实际测试过),对script标签进行合并,毕竟页面遇到script标签就会停止渲染(主要是因为浏览器不能确定script标签会不会改动dom),在使用ajax时,对一些内容尽量使用get(get默认会保留缓存...
...隐藏起来的,当前文件中肉眼看不到的原型:原型是Javascript继承中的核心,通过对原型链从最上层向最下层进行查找,来实现方法的调用。写一个我最近遇到的例子来直观的理解: html文件中的script: var myProgressOne = new mProg...
...供给其他用户使用的页面中,可以简单的理解为一种javascript代码注入。XSS的防御措施: 过滤转义输入输出 避免使用eval、new Function等执行字符串的方法,除非确定字符串和用户输入无关 使用cookie的httpOnly属性,加上了这个属性...
...供给其他用户使用的页面中,可以简单的理解为一种javascript代码注入。XSS的防御措施: 过滤转义输入输出 避免使用eval、new Function等执行字符串的方法,除非确定字符串和用户输入无关 使用cookie的httpOnly属性,加上了这个属性...
...供给其他用户使用的页面中,可以简单的理解为一种javascript代码注入。XSS的防御措施: 过滤转义输入输出 避免使用eval、new Function等执行字符串的方法,除非确定字符串和用户输入无关 使用cookie的httpOnly属性,加上了这个属性...
所有的web开发都是【请求】+【响应】 推荐JavaScript中使用单引号引用字符串,HTML中使用双引号,防止冲突 JavaScript代码、网页代码执行顺序是从上到下依次执行 标签,在浏览器不支持JavaScript内容时会展示noscript标签内的内...
...说出大概意思也可以。(推荐写出来,边写边讲原理)4.script标签的defer和async有什么区别这个自己看一下就好,不是特别难,而且问的概率不大。 开发类 1.关于页面缓存的问题这个就比较简单了,只要看几篇文章就可以回答的...
前端面试题JavaScript(一) JavaScript的组成 JavaScript 由以下三部分组成: ECMAScript(核心):JavaScript 语言基础 DOM(文档对象模型):规定了访问HTML和XML的接口 BOM(浏览器对象模型):提供了浏览器窗口之间进行交互的对象...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...
图示为GPU性能排行榜,我们可以看到所有GPU的原始相关性能图表。同时根据训练、推理能力由高到低做了...